Description

The Food Chemistry division of The Department of Agriculture, Food and the Marine (DAFM) laboratories analyses food samples for various residues of pesticides, veterinary drugs and contaminants. The current methods of analysis involve manual sample preparation, extraction and clean-up which is time consuming and open to handling errors. The division is aiming to procure an automated system which will handle most of the extraction process for the method for fruit and vegetables – described below. The automated system should be flexible so that it can be modified to handle the extraction for other methods. DAFM reserves the right to purchase up to an additional three (3) of these systems over the next five (5) years from the date of contract award.
